About Us

An American owned and operated company since 1898, W.B. Mason has been delivering workplace essentials to keep businesses running for over 120 years. A leader in B2B eCommerce, Supply Chain Management and Distribution, you’ve probably seen our iconic red and yellow trucks, adorned with the image of our founder William Betts Mason, as they deliver tens-of-thousands of orders each day throughout New England and the Eastern United States.

Originally built on Office Supplies, we’ve since expanded to offer innovative, cost effective and customized solutions to an ever-evolving set of business requirements; selling and delivering over 15 product lines that span from Janitorial Supplies, Food Service, Shipping & Packaging, Breakroom and Furniture, to everything in between for every type of business.

About the Opportunity

Providing direct support to the Sr. Director of Risk Management, the Property & Casuality Insurance Specialist assists with management and administration of W.B. Mason's Total Cost of Risk. This role is set in a Hybrid work environment, meaning employees will work partly remote and partly in-office, with in-office time required for training. The reporting in-office location for this role is our Corporate Headquarters, located in Brockton, MA.



Responsibilities

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Claims Management and Administration:
    • Auto Liability, Auto Physical Damage, General Liability and Workers’ Compensation claim administration, reporting, trending and analysis
    • Establish monthly/quarterly loss reporting of claims; identify issues and trends
    • Investigate, process and track property damage claims handled outside of insurance program
    • Liaison with Fleet Management Department to ensure claims are reported and property damage claims are processed timely
    • Monitor and flag key risk indicators and implement corrective actions to mitigate/alleviate property/casualty claims
    • Attend quarterly Auto Liability, General Liability and Workers’ Compensation claim reviews
  • Insurance Renewal:
    • Maintain and update WB Mason’s Schedule of Property values
    • Responsible for gathering insurance renewal documentation from internal stakeholders to prepare for submission to insurance broker
    • Prior experience with high deductible, loss sensitive Property/Casualty programs
  • Certificates of Insurance and other duties:
    • Process Certificates of Insurance (COI) requests in accordance with specific insurance requirements as provided by customers/vendors
    • Administer Ohio & Washington Workers’ Compensation state filings, quarterly reporting and payment of premiums
    • Vendor management/vendor credentialing
    • Maintain insurance payment schedule, premium invoice reconciliation and process risk management-related invoices
    • Review contractual insurance provisions to ensure compliance with customer insurance requirements and flag non-standard language to internal stakeholders
